The CEC code allows the use of overcurrent protection device rated at 125% of the rating of a dry type transformer with primary voltage below 750V, overcurrent protection on the secondary side is not required.
Are the transformers built to withstand the load at 125% for long periods of time? Is the 125% primary o/c rating to allow for in-rush?

Rule 8-104 (5),(a)
Most continuous loads are required to be supplied with conductors and overcurrent devices rated or set at 125% of the load current as a code requirement.
